Whiteparish Parish Council

PARISH COUNCIL NOTES
From the meeting held 1st November 2001 in the Village Hall


Matters Arising from last meeting
Safe walkway to the school - WCC have requested changes to a report on proposed scheme by Ringway Parkman. Footpath 1 alongside Rose Cottage has been cleared; further up the path to be investigated. Following advice from the Charity Commission and requests from the public, the Memorial Ground Trust, the Village Hall Committee and the Parish Council are to have a meeting to see if a way forward can be found so that a new village hall could be sited on the Memorial Ground. If general agreement can be reached in the village, Charity Commission to be contacted again. SDC Planning Enforcement have stopped the construction of an unauthorised building at Harestock and thanked the Parish Council for notifying them about it. Camper van is still parked on a site adjacent to Brickworth Road and SDC Planning Enforcement are pursuing this.

Environment
Footpath 2 from the A36 to the A27 is impassable; to be reported to the owner of the land. The footpath from Dean Lane to Miles Lane is being used by horses; it is not a bridleway. To be investigated.

Skateboard Park
Reports of bad behaviour received. The Memorial Ground Management Committee to investigate filling in the sides of the skateboard equipment. PC Day to be contacted to continue to monitor the situation, particularly regarding reports of drug taking. Any members of the public are asked to report any bad behaviour via 999 calls.

Planning
There has been a planning application to convert redundant farm buildings on Miles Lane at New Manor Farm to a residential dwelling. The Planning Committee objected to the size and siting of the garages/stores block and felt that this block should be moved away from the road and should have a condition attached to prevent possible use for business in the future.

Proposed New Forest National Park
The Countryside Agency are to decide the next step by the end of the year. If there is to be a public enquiry, it will be in autumn 2002. The PC have proposed the exclusion of Whiteparish from the National Park, as have SDC.

Correspondence
Wilts. & Swindon Waste Local Plan 2011 First Deposit Draft has been received and is being circulated for comments to the PC Environment Committee. The Chairman is to attend the nearest Community Liaison Event in Amesbury on 14th November.
Invitation to a Parish Council Liaison meeting with SDC received for 5th December; Chairman and Clerk to attend.
A request for a bus shelter for school students outside Brympton Stables on Common Road had been received; it was decided not to support this as there are other places where other, larger groups have to wait in the village and also there would be problems in cleaning and maintaining another shelter.
In response to public concerns that yellow "no parking" lines were planned in the village outside the shop, it was emphasised that there are no such plans.
